Re: Correct steering position sensor?
Looks like the part number is either:
1J0 959 654AG
1J0 959 654AL
1J0 959 654M
Depending on your option codes.

Re: Correct steering position sensor?
AG:
2ZS = Leather trimmed multi-function steering wheel with Tiptronic
2FL = Leather trimmed multi-function steering wheel with Tiptronic
AL:
2ZD = Heated leather trimmed multi-function steering wheel with Tiptronic
2FK = Heated leather trimmed multi-function steering wheel with Tiptronic
M:
1MU = Leather trimmed sports steering wheel for air bag system with Tiptronic
1XY = Leather trimmed multi-function sports steering wheel w/ Tiptronic
